Most times, investors are in a dilemma whether or not to trust stock tips and investment strategies. Although they may rely on their informants, who typically are confidante, friends or relatives, uncertainties still linger over their minds as to how much to invest and the extent of possible risks. Sadly, the stock investment tips do not comprise ideas that deal on when to invest.

To conduct wise decisions, an investor must consider the following factors:

1. Take the source into account

Stock investment tips may come as real and effective. But sometimes, it becomes inefficient. This especially happens when the information gets spoiled due to alteration upon dissemination. It is then best to evaluate those who have exposed the tips and observe the current price conditions of the market. Usually, the stocks which have been gradually increasing undergo price retract before rising further. It may be worthwhile to anticipate for a pull back before acquiring stocks. Keep in mind that majority of investment tips could not be fully relied on and despite widespread issues of good firm; stocks are still bound to undergo struggles before it rises in the market.

2. Secure your stock investments

Stocks are bound to expand or diminish regardless whether the stock investment strategies and tips are right or wrong. But in order to grow, a trader must invest in the market. If one wishes to finance in any stock, he must consider the following measures.

  • First, he must personally evaluate the stock in order to ascertain the tip. He must assess whether the tip is worth trusting and is not just merely false public information. There are instances when rumors keep on lingering amongst the public when in fact it is already diminished.
  • Secondly, consider having a stop-loss price. This comes in handy when you would trade your stock if its value drops. Also, it is good to have decent sell points when objectives are reached.
  • Third, exert efforts to lessen small losses. Disregarded deficit often go beyond and becomes large ones.
  • And finally, inquire the source for tips as to the extent where the stocks should be sold. Reading latest stock market news can be of great help.

3. Take cautions on stocks

The Securities and Exchange Commission has imposed regulations that every trader must observe. As an investor, you have to check whether or not the source is an official or a representative of the rumored firm. If yes, ensure that there have been no PRs (public release) of the same intelligence. Or if not, and the stock news and reports are confirmed as true, you might be violating the rule. Constantly observe the movement of the stock. Look for good signs such as recent increase in prices and of stock volume. Be careful when the trading volume grows despite the decline in stock price. If this happens a few times in such a short time, the reports are possibly wrong or merely just an old public knowledge.
